To the incoming director: Ashgrove product line winds down end of Q4. Manufacturing at the Kellport site stops in October; spares commitment runs eighteen months. Remaining inventory moves through the Varstead outlet channel at reduced margin. Two suppliers still under notice — contracts with Morrowfield and Tessick terminate cleanly, no penalties. Customer comms drafted, not yet sent. Staff redeployment plan is with HR. Read the confidential item immediately below before your first steering meeting.

internal memo for fajog-yagaf: Gross margin on Ulaael came in at 20 percent against a plan of 10 percent. Only 9 of the 80 pilot accounts renewed Ulaael, so a churn review is set for July 1.

### Ledger Review — Notes (excerpt)

Discussed the Pennywheel loyalty-points ledger migration. Agreed that all balance adjustments must go through the double-entry path; direct writes are now rejected at the API layer. Reviewers should verify idempotency keys on every adjustment before approving. Final sign-off on ledger-touching changes belongs to the engineer named below.

named custodian: Oliath Ralax

Firmware channel promotion failed twice this week on the Lanternbox OTA pipeline. The staging channel rejects artifacts signed with the rotated key because the verifier image in CI is pinned to an older manifest. Support should tell customers on the beta ring that updates are paused, not failed — devices will retry automatically once we unpin. Do not advise manual flashing. The fix lands with the next verifier bump. For escalations, reference the last known-good build below.

pipeline stamp: htk31_f769b577b3028a4e9958e5bb8d1259a